Reusable Block and Synced Pattern Count is a WordPress plugin that adds a Synced Patterns entry to the admin menu and displays how many posts use each pattern. It helps site owners and editors manage and track reusable content blocks efficiently within the WordPress dashboard.

It focuses on tracking and managing the usage of reusable blocks and synced patterns in WordPress sites. It is built as a consumer product for wordPress site owners and editors. Reusable Block and Synced Pattern Count costs nothing to use. It ships for the web.
It is developed by George Stephanis, and it first shipped in 2021. Key capabilities include pattern usage count, admin menu integration, and posts filter. The interface is available in English and Nepali.
